Pre-existing issues: - [High] The fix for dropped pending interrupts during CPU hot-unplug was missed in the sister Hyper-V root partition MSI domain. -- --- Patch [1]: [PATCH 1/3] PCI: hv: Set irq_retrigger callback for the Hyper-V PCI MSI irqchip --- commit b8b1c843c457dd145f0d360b44f4b1bf34bd8cf5 Author: Naman Jain <[email protected]> PCI: hv: Set irq_retrigger callback for the Hyper-V PCI MSI irqchip The Hyper-V vPCI MSI irqchip never installs an irq_retrigger() callback. On CPU hot-unplug fixup_irqs() migrates the interrupts which are affine to the outgoing CPU to a new target. As the Hyper-V PCI/MSI chip does not provide that callback, the pending interrupt is silently dropped, which can result in lost interrupts, stalls and "No irq handler for vector" messages. Looking at hv_init_dev_msi_info(), it appears to be missing the exact same callback initialization for the root partition's top-level irq_chip: arch/x86/hyperv/irqdomain.c:hv_init_dev_msi_info() { ... if (!msi_lib_init_dev_msi_info(dev, domain, real_parent, info)) return false; chip->flags |= IRQCHIP_SKIP_SET_WAKE | IRQCHIP_MOVE_DEFERRED; info->ops->msi_prepare = pci_msi_prepare; return true; } If a CPU is hot-unplugged while a device MSI interrupt is pending in its local APIC IRR, could fixup_irqs() fail to resend the pending interrupt to the new target CPU because this callback is NULL? This could potentially lead to the same lost interrupts and I/O stalls described in this commit message, just in the root partition MSI domain instead of the guest paravirtual MSI domain. > > if (IS_ENABLED(CONFIG_X86)) > chip->flags |= IRQCHIP_MOVE_DEFERRED; > -- Sashiko AI review ยท https://sashiko.dev/#/patchset/[email protected]?part=1
